新生儿缺氧缺血性脑病临床分度与CT征象相关性分析  被引量:10

Analysis on the correlation between clinical degree and CT features of the neonates with h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y

摘  要:目的:研究新生儿缺氧缺血性脑病(HIE)临床分度与CT征象的相关性。方法:对54例HIE的临床及CT影像资料进行回顾性分析。对所有患儿均进行临床分度、CT分度,并按是否合并颅内出血分组。结果:临床分度与CT分度呈中度相关,临床分度随CT分度的增加而增加;与CT值呈中度相关,CT值随临床分度的增加而降低;是否合并颅内出血在临床分度上有统计学差异,合并颅内出血以中至重度为多,两组在CT值上无明显差异。结论:临床与CT分度在中至重度的判定上有良好的一致性,但在轻度的判定有一定的出入;随着脑的缺氧缺血性损害的加重CT值明显下降,颅内出血的几率也增加;对新生儿HIE最重要的诊断依据仍然是病史和临床表现,CT扫描作为辅助手段对判断病情的轻重则有重要价值。Objective: To research the correlation between clinical degree and CT features of the neonates with hypoxic - ischemic encephalopathy (HIE) . Methods: The clinical data and CT imaging data of 54 neonates with HIE were analyzed retrospectively. All the neonates underwent clinical grading and CT grading, then they were divided into different groups according to whether they were combined with cerebral bleeding. Results: There was a moderate correlation between clinical grade and CT grade, clinical grade increased with the increase of CT grade, which was correlated with CT value moderately ; CT value decreased with the increase of clinical grade; there was significant difference in the clinical grade between the neonates with cerebral bleeding and the neonates without cerebral bleeding; most of the neo- nates with cerebral bleeding had moderate to severe HIE, there was no significant difference in CT value between the two groups. Conclusion: The consistency of clinical grade and CT grade is good for predicting moderate to severe HIE, but there is a certain difference in predicting mild HIE ; CT value decreases significantly with the aggravation of HIE, the probability of cerebral bleeding also increases; the most important diagnostic criteria for neonatal HIE are still medical history and clinical manifestations, CT scanning can be used as an assisted technique to predict the degree of the disease.
